I want to setup an automator script to watch for changes in a folder (new pictures added) and add the photos to a Photos album. I added the "Import Files into Photos" item and received the error when I ran it within automator:

Screen Shot 2022-01-22 at 1.12.37 PM.png


So I added the "Get Specified Finder Items" action.

Screen Shot 2022-01-23 at 9.41.50 AM.png

No change. Still get the error message.

When running the workflow as a folder action, it gets passed items that have been added to the target folder, but when running from Automator, it isn’t a folder action, so the workflow won’t automatically have any items passed to it. As mentioned in the dialog, you can temporarily add an action such as Get Specified Finder Items to get something for the workflow to use for testing or whatever. When specifying the same folder that you are using for the folder action, if you are expecting it to work the same as a folder action, that isn't going to happen. If there aren’t any image files in the folder for the Import Files into Photos action, then it will error because it doesn’t have any input, so you might try another action such as Ask for Finder Items to select known image files.
